// readUnsolicited handles messages sent to the unsolicited channel and parse them
|
||||
// into a WPAEvent. At the moment we only handle `CTRL-EVENT-*` events and only events
|
||||
// where the 'payload' is formatted with key=val.
|
||||
func (uc *unixgramConn) readUnsolicited() {
|
||||
for {
|
||||
mgs := <-uc.unsolicited
|
||||
data := bytes.NewBuffer(mgs.data).String()
|
||||
|
||||
parts := strings.Split(data, " ")
|
||||
if len(parts) == 0 {
|
||||
continue
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
if strings.Index(parts[0], "CTRL-") != 0 {
|
||||
continue
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
event := WPAEvent{
|
||||
Event: strings.TrimPrefix(parts[0], "CTRL-EVENT-"),
|
||||
Arguments: make(map[string]string),
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
for _, args := range parts[1:] {
|
||||
if strings.Contains(args, "=") {
|
||||
keyval := strings.Split(args, "=")
|
||||
if len(keyval) != 2 {
|
||||
continue
|
||||
}
|
||||
event.Arguments[keyval[0]] = keyval[1]
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
uc.wpaEvents <- event
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
